And we’ll be proud to have you on the journey.\n\nAt Sentry Equipment, a subsidiary of ProMach’s Systems business, we have a longstanding reputation in the industries we serve. We offer an extensive portfolio of conveyor equipment and related container handling machinery. We specialize in integrating packaging equipment and conveying systems into cost‑effective and efficient plan designs.\n\nDo we have your attention?\n\nOur Engineering team works closely on each piece of equipment to ensure the highest quality and innovative solutions. As a Controls Engineer, you will be respon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ining electrical control systems for our conveyor systems and automated machines. This role requires a strong understanding of control systems, electrical engineering principles, and hands‑on experience with industrial automation, and the ability and willingness to travel to customer sites for start‑ups and/or service items. Travel is estimated at up to 35%.\n\nAre you excited about this work?\n\nDesign and develop electrical control systems for new and existing products.\n\nCreate detailed electrical sensor layouts, help with generating electrical schematics for conveyor systems and other machines.\n\nProgram and configure PLCs, HMIs, and other control devices using Rockwell software.\n\nTroubleshoot and resolve issues with existing control systems.\n\nCollaborate with cross‑functional teams to ensure system integration and performance.\n\nConduct testing and validation of control systems to 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ations.\n\nBenefits\nIn addition to growth opportunities, as a ProMach employee, you receive more than just a paycheck.
